A George V sterling silver gilt inkwell, London 1919 by Sebastion Garrard

A George V sterling silver gilt inkwell, London 1919 by Sebastion Garrard

In the Régence style, of hexagonal form upon a stepped and bracket footed base, the panelled sides with chased decoration of foliate scrolls and beaded strapwork, against lattices and mattted grounds. The hinged domed cover similarly decorated with chased foliate scrolls surmounted by an amorphous finial. The interior with recess for a glass inkwell (deficent). Fully marked to base and part-marked to lid.

Length – 11.5 cm / 4.5 inches

Weight – 341 grams / 10.96 ozt

Provenance: sold Christie’s South Kensington, 18 Nov 2010, lot 55 (£937 incl. prem)

Sold for £403
